Ecological measurement of biodiversity

From the above discussion, it can be appreciated that the primary interest in measuring

biodiversity is that biodiversity level is an indicator of well-being of ecological systems, which

also dictate the productivity to humankind of those systems. Biodiversity has two dimensions:

richness (variety) and abundance (number). Ecologists typically utilise three types of

biodiversity measure:

• Species richness indices – a measure of the number of species in a defined

sampling unit.

• Species abundance indices – compares the level of evenness amongst numbers of each

species versus unevenness (unequal). Usually some species are abundant whereas

most are not i.e. a few species dominate.

• Proportional abundance indices – which seek to summarise richness and evenness into

a single figure e.g. Shannon and Simpson indices.
